Some thoughts...

- This was as 60-minutes as you're going to get. A great defensive first, got the flood gates opened in the second, and then shut it down in the third. I don't care if Sarnia's ninth, they've always played Windsor well.
- A nice hatty from Morneau. What a 15th rounder! In the post-game (YouTube), you can tell how much all of this meant to him. He'll be missed next season.
- Abraham with a couple of points. Another kid that's going to be missed. He made a comment post-game that stood out, saying the OAs in his rookie season told him to take it slow. He didn't listen and the time has flown by. Something about "I wish I had listened better." Time can be weird if you're not soaking it in; good lesson for everyone, regardless of age.
- Five assists by Protas. We were laughing. "let me guess... Protas helper? THERE IT IS!" The Spitfires' record is six in a game, back in 1982.
- Speaking of records, 52pt improvement is single-season Spitfires' record. Previous was 51 in the early Rychel years. They've had some issues this season but we're watching history. I'm going to pull a Morneau and soak it all in.
- I'm trying to think of something "Not so good", but... darn near everyone played well tonight. I'll take it.
- Woodall's hit wasn't good; I saw it out of the corner of my eye. He jumps, hits the guy in the head, and... that'll likely be a couple or four games. You can't do that in a game that means nothing.
- That said... if the trip had been called in front of the net a few seconds earlier, Woodall's hit doesn't happen. I wasn't a fan of the officiating tonight, both ways.
- I don't know the extent of Belchetz's injury but hopefully it's not a long-term thing. I know it's his leg/ankle, last I heard, so we'll see. I didn't see the hit so I can't comment much on it. I know that Walters said it wasn't Hurt's fault (post-game).
- Costanzo is not likely playing in London, per Walters post-game. My guess... Newlove and Froggett split the time. Who starts? I don't know. You'll likely see a player or two called up. Robinson seems likely with Georgetown out. Maybe someone like Hjelholt, as he was with King Rebellion, I believe. They're out of the playoffs. LaSalle is still playing so Lavigne is out. Now, I’m not surprised it was called two on the ice. IF Greentree got a penalty for his, I would’ve assumed it was two as well.

I think the two is a better assessment for the act.

Greentree was given 5 for an assumed injury, which was nothing. Hurt was given 2, for the act.

I’d rather guys be penalized for their actions, not the result of their actions. There’s a lot of clean hits that result in injuries, welcome to hockey bud, move on. You intentionally swing your stick at someone’s head, whether you knock him unconscious or not, you gotta Guo.

Hurt was making a defensive play on the guy with the puck, it sucks Belchetz got hurt. Greentree was making a play to obtain the puck, it sucks Dickinson fell down.

NOW, I Agree more with the call last night than on Greentree from the Refs. But the league can’t review these nearly identical incidents and suspend one and not the other… can they?

The plays are similar, but they aren't at the same time.

Greentree hits Dickinson in the back & is far closer to the boards. I don't think he deserved a SSPD but I think most would agree his cross check is at a more dangerous area and into the back.

Hurt hits Belchetz in the hip pretty much at the faceoff dot.

As Walters said post game it was really unfortunate for Ethan & 0 intention from Hurt.
